Hello friends

I have sent w-8ben form to agents in united states. I waiting since 2 months but no reply to me. So please anybody help me about how much time takes for w-8 for processing.. Thanks

MukatA
May 27, 2010, 01:47 AM
It does not require to be processed. It is submitted to inform the company that you are not a resident or citizen of the U.S.
The company making you payment will withhold taxes based on your foreign status or W-8BEN.

Hello friends
I want to about how to send w-8ben form. Is its by mail or by post.
I still I don't know. Please help me . Thank you people.

AtlantaTaxExpert
May 28, 2010, 09:57 AM
The Form W-8BEn is NOT submitted to the IRS. It is sent to your employer, bank, brokerage house or client to provide written documentation of whether you are subject to backup wthholding or not.

When I complete a Form W-8BEN for a client, I typically tell them to sign it, then scan-and-email the SIGNED Form W-8BEN to the bank/brokerage/client to satisfy their initial need, followed up by a MAILED copy via normal mail. The signed W-8BEN is typically good for THREE years until anew one is needed.
